This NSN is assigned to Item Name Code (INC) 00746. [A TERMINAL DESIGNED TO BE AFFIXED, USUALLY AT ONE END, TO A POST, STUD, CHASSIS, OR THE LIKE FOR MOUNTING. IT HAS PROVISIONS FOR ATTACHMENT OF WIRE(S) OR SIMILAR ELECTRICAL CONDUCTOR(S) IN ORDER TO ESTABLISH AN ELECTRICAL CONNECTION AND COULD REQUIRE THE USE OF TOOL(S) FOR ATTACHMENT OF WIRE. FOR POST LIKE TERMINALS, SEE TERMINAL STUD. EXCLUDES:CLIP, ELECTRICAL; TERMINAL, QUICK DISCONNECT AND TERMINAL FEEDTHRU.].
